Pochettino: “The important thing is to be here in May”

The manager of Espanyol appeared pleased with his team’s work

Mauricio Pochettino, manager of RCD Espanyol, assured at his post-game press conference after beating Atlético de Madrid that he was very satisfied with the game played by his players. Pochettino stated that “Espanyol showed that we’re an ambitious team with a lot of attitude. We’re competing and maturing at the same time, with excitement and character beyond what is reflected on one’s identity card.”

The Argentine head coach emphasized that “we have to enjoy the moment. Fourth place is a temporary thing in this competition and the truly important thing will be to work more intensely from now on to make it to the last week in the same situation. The important thing is for us to be here in May.”
 
Pochettino was very discrete and prudent regarding the controversy stemming from the final moments. “I didn’t see anything; giving an opinion would be to talk for the sake of talking. The only thing that I tried to do was calm everyone down so that none of my players were harmed by an officiating decision. What happens on the pitch should stay there,” he concluded.
